华为云国际站:JDBC连接云数据库MySQL实践指南
一、华为云数据库MySQL的核心优势
华为云数据库MySQL凭借高性能、高可靠性和全球部署能力,成为企业级应用的首选:
- 金融级高可用 – 跨AZ部署+秒级故障切换,年故障时间≤30秒
- 极致性能优化 – 采用智能SSD存储引擎,QPS可达50万+
- 全链路安全防护 – 支持TDE透明加密、VPC隔离和SQL防火墙
- 全球低延迟访问 – 覆盖亚太、欧洲、拉美等15个地理区域
二、JDBC连接配置详解
2.1 基础连接参数配置
String url = "jdbc:mysql://{instance_address}:{port}/{database_name}?useSSL=true&requireSSL=true";
String user = "root";
String password = "Your_Password123";
2.2 高性能连接池配置建议
- 推荐使用HikariCP连接池,配合华为云弹性云服务器可实现毫秒级响应
- 连接数公式:connections = (core_count * 2) + effective_spindle_count
- 华为云特有的TCP优化协议可提升30%网络吞吐量
三、华为云专属优化方案
3.1 智能读写分离配置
通过华为云ProxySQL中间件自动路由读写请求:

jdbc:mysql://proxysql-endpoint:6033/db?loadBalance=true
3.2 多活数据库连接策略
利用华为云Global Database Service实现跨区域容灾:
- 自动故障转移时间<30秒
- 数据同步延迟<1秒
- 支持权重分配读写流量
四、典型架构实践
4.1 电商系统高并发方案
华为云ECS+C3ne型实例(计算优化型)配合MySQL读写分离:
- 前端采用ELB自动扩展
- 业务层部署在Kubernetes集群
- 数据库使用16核64G内存规格
4.2 物联网大数据场景
华为云GaussDB(for MySQL)分布式架构:
- 单实例最大支持128TB存储
- 内置时序数据库引擎
- 与MapReduce服务无缝对接
五、最佳实践总结
华为云数据库MySQL服务与弹性云服务器的组合为企业提供了:
| 功能维度 | 技术实现 | 商业价值 |
|---|---|---|
| 高性能访问 | C6/C7系列ECS+智能网卡 | 降低30%硬件成本 |
| 数据安全 | 数据库审计+云堡垒机 | 满足等保三级要求 |
| 全球部署 | CDN+全球数据库网络 | 跨国业务延迟<100ms |
建议用户结合自身业务特点选择:
- 中小企业:MySQL+ECS基础型组合
- 中大型企业:分布式数据库+裸金属服务器
- 跨国企业:Global Database+海外Region部署
发布者:luotuoemo,转转请注明出处:https://www.jintuiyun.com/412493.html